About the role

The Architectural Project Manager will lead, manage, and design healthcare projects across the Farnsworth Group's nationwide Healthcare Studio. This position requires a strong background in architecture, particularly in the healthcare sector, and a passion for creating spaces that improve patient care and community impact.

Responsibilities

  • Lead, manage, and design healthcare projects across the firm, collaborating with architecture, engineering, business development, and marketing teams.
  • Manage multi-disciplinary teams from concept to delivery, ensuring projects meet high standards of quality and compliance.
  • Mentor junior architectural staff, providing guidance and support to help them grow professionally.
  • Generate work and build long-term client relationships through active participation in business development and project pursuits.
  • Create, review, and approve proposals, reports, and contract documents, ensuring accuracy and adherence to company standards.

Requirements

  • Bachelor’s degree in Architecture from an accredited program, with a Master’s degree preferred.
  • At least 10 years of architectural work experience, with a strong focus on healthcare projects.
  • Knowledgeable in healthcare industry trends, evidence-based design principles, and lean delivery methods.
  • Demonstrated project management and supervisory experience, including successful client development and relationship maintenance.
  • Proficiency in Revit software is a plus.
  • Exceptional interpersonal communication, organizational, coordination, leadership, team-building, and managerial skills.
